Biden campaign gets boost with Virginia win in Democratic primary

Virginians gave former Vice President Joe Biden a big win in Tuesday’s Democratic presidential primary, winning over half of the 1.3 million-plus votes cast statewide. Local results mirrored those of the Commonwealth as a whole, with Biden winning Gloucester with 54.06 percent of the votes cast and the percentage was somewhat higher in Mathews County, with Biden getting 55.63 percent of the vote. Senator Bernie Sanders polled second in the two counties, garnering 22.77 percent of Gloucester’s vote and 19.3 percent of the Mathews vote. Former New York City Mayor Michael Bloomberg did somewhat better locally than he did statewide, placing third in both Mathews (12.17 percent) and Gloucester (10.26 percent) counties. Statewide, Bloomberg came in fourth with 9.66 percent of the vote, where he was edged out by Senator Elizabeth Warren with 10.77 percent.
